Walking, Hiking and Biking
The hamlet Krize is a special place for
walking.
The peaks within two or three miles are higher than Snowdon or
Table Mountain and one can walk for miles above an altitude of 1,000m.
In summer at this height the weather is warm, the air clean
and scented with meadow flowers and forest resins.
Krize lies between two major walking paths E3 and E8 that run the length of Europe.
Some of the walks are also suitable for mountain bikes.

Bird Watching
Krize is a very good place for
bird watching.
The unspoilt forests around Krize and the variety of trees provide a favourite habitat for many birds.
Close to Krize the walking path E3 goes through pine woods, E8 goes through beech woods and
together they go through oak woods.

Fishing
We are very fortunate to be able to offer you as your
fishing
guide one of the most experienced anglers.
Mr Miroslav Sykora has a bronze medal from the World Fly-fishing Championships held in Belgium in 1986,
when the Czech Nymphs were first introduced.
Krize is a good base for fishing.
The World Fly Fishing Championships 2004 and
the European Coarse Fishing Championships 2005 were held in Slovakia.

Water Sports
Rafting
About an hour's drive towards the High Tatras is a deep gorge
with the fast flowing river Dunajec which is used for
white-water rafting
in spring when it is full with melting snow.
Later in the year, especially further downstream where the river is calmer,
more traditional log rafts are used for pleasure rides.
Canoeing and Kayaking
The Dunajec is also ideal for canoeing and kayaking. Canoes and kayaks are available for hire, as are instructors for all levels of experience.
Slovakia was the most successful nation in this sport at the last Olympic Games
in Athens with two golds and one silver, and had similar success in the previous two Games.
